Flemish Red Cross clashes openly with Princess Astrid
Since a long time the relationship between the Flemish (Dutch speaking) and Wallonian (French speaking) branches of the Belgian Red Cross is very tensed. The core underlying problem is that the Flemish branch has its books in order, enjoys a surplus on its budget and is managed well. The Wallonian branch is the opposite.
Flemish members of the Board of the Belgian Red Cross and many Flemish volunteers want to break the Belgian Red Cross, to get the smoothly operated Flemish branch indepent from its problematic Wallonian sister-organiation.
Princess Astrid, since 1995 the president of the Belgian Red Cross, has fiercely opposed the tendences in the Flemish branch to break away from the Belgian Red Cross.....
Source: Het Belang van Limburg - online krant

**New news...
Apparantly Guido Kestens, has resigned as chairman of the Flemish Red Cross. Mr Kestens said he felt a lack of support after his decision to sack Princess Astrid's personal assistant.
Princess Astrid doesn't favour a "regionalisation" of the Belgian Red Cross, which would create a separate Flemish and Francophone division.
Some say that the decision to sack her personal assistant, Ms Rutten, was a move by the Flemish Red Cross to get back at the Princess.
